Make sure there is not an index on that file being updated with a key >
255 characters.

We encountered a problem during our nightly batch processing last night
and it pertains to a specific
record/key. The error that we received in our log is as follows:

--
Program "LFBDOPOS": Line 337, Attempted WRITE with record ID larger than
file/table maximum
record ID size of 255 characters.
Program "LFBDOPOS": Line 337, FATAL: Unable to do commit of record
"15500*60431*EJK" in file "GENACCTRN_POSTED/DATA.30".
Program "LFBDOPOS": Line 337, Rolling back uncommitted transactions
begun within this execution environment.
Attempted WRITE with record ID larger than file/table maximum
record ID size of 255 characters.
--

I checked our MAXKEYSIZE in UniAdmin and it's set to 255. 

I guess my question is why is it saying the ID/primary key is too large
if it should be -> 15500*60431*EJK ?

Also, what do we do to fix this? Any help is appreciated, thanks!
